Output 284a699eaf3824c3df56153f033b83813b1c6aa5a8fea0b9c210dcdeb79a8bec:3

value
73597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9875793ba0916578241396284de3a1098f8126d OP_EQUAL
address
3L4bsqQqHDFmngf2FD4sFSfY4teXREawxe
transaction
284a699eaf3824c3df56153f033b83813b1c6aa5a8fea0b9c210dcdeb79a8bec
spent
true